'Musandam Winter' campaign to boost tourism in governorate

 
MUSCAT: According to Omar bin Ali al Shuhi, history researcher, Musandam Governorate owes its name to the Cape of Musandam, an island on the Sea of Oman adjoining Kamzar maritime village. The island is but a hilltop in the middle of the sea surrounded by rock islands the most prominent of which is Salama Island.

The Sultanate of Oman’s attention to wildlife and maritime life has been manifested in the issuance of Royal Decree No (54/2022) which established the National Natural Park Reserve in the Governorate of Musandam. The governorate comprises 23 islands, 13 of which are quite large.

'The most important among them is the Telegraph Island locally known as Maqlab Island. It is home to the first modern communications cable in the Arabian Gulf, The submarine cable stretches from the city of Mumbai in India and the city of Basra in Iraq. The island of Maqlab is home to the transmit station,' Al Shuhi said.

Musandam Island is the largest island in Musandam Governorate, second only to Aum Al Ghanam Island. Musandam Island, overlooking the Strait of Hormuz, is among the most stunning places in Oman. It boasts significant historic landmarks such as Ras al Bab. The island boasts scenic views, emerald beaches and beautiful plains that attract tourists seeking to enjoy mountain hiking and long-distance trekking.

Seebi Island, located in the Wilayat of Khasab in Khor Sham, is one of the most eye-catching tourist attractions of Musandam Governorate. With a beautiful sandy crescent-shaped beach, the island is a good place for kayaking.
